As if the late-breaking Friday night news of merger talks between Chrysler and GM weren't astonishing enough, Bill "Pickles" Vlasic at the New York Times continued the onslaught of amazement with a follow-up story that GM had initially approached Ford before speaking to Chrysler. Apparently, GM execs approached Ford about a possible merger in July but Ford rejected the idea despite the talks progressing until as late as last month. And we though ...

Financing lawsuit threatens Chrysler-Getrag dual clutch transmissions
Filed under: ChryslerThe current credit crisis could be playing further havoc with Chrysler's future powertrain product plans. In the first half of 2007, Chrysler announced investment plans to build two new engine plants and a transmission plant for 2010 model cars. The transmission facility was to be a joint venture with Getrag to build fuel saving dual clutch transmissions. Chrysler already offers German-built Getrag DCTs in the European specif...
